BISMUTH SUBNITRATE.

Valuable CAS 1304-85-4 / ABSORBENT, OPACIFYING

Bismuth Subnitrate is a multi-functional inorganic salt renowned for its astringent, soothing, and protective effects on the skin. It is frequently utilized in topical formulations to alleviate irritation and inflammation.

astringent adsorbent protective mild antimicrobial opacifying soothing

Science

It functions by promoting the contraction of skin cells, providing astringent, adsorbent, and protective qualities. Its mild antimicrobial properties further aid in soothing and healing minor skin irritations and wounds.

Commonly dusted

This ingredient has a history of use in dusting powders for treating indolent, moist, or suppurating lesions.

Stability

A white, slightly hygroscopic powder, Bismuth Subnitrate is practically insoluble in water and ethanol. No specific optimal pH range for stability in cosmetic formulations was identified.

Conflicts

  • alkaline bicarbonates
  • soluble iodides
  • gallic acid
  • calomel
  • salicylic acid
  • tannin
  • sulfur

Safety

CIR Status
Not reviewed
Sensitization risk Low

The safety profile is generally favorable, with minimal absorption and virtually no toxicity. While FDA-approved for oral antacids, some reports indicate potential skin/eye irritation, though it generally does not meet GHS hazard criteria.
